| Long: range
 | |
| Short: r
 | |
| Help: Retrieve only the bytes within RANGE
 | |
| Arg: <range>
 | |
| Protocols: HTTP FTP SFTP FILE
 | |
| ---
 | |
| Retrieve a byte range (i.e a partial document) from a HTTP/1.1, FTP or SFTP
 | |
| server or a local FILE. Ranges can be specified in a number of ways.
 | |
| .RS
 | |
| .TP 10
 | |
| .B 0-499
 | |
| specifies the first 500 bytes
 | |
| .TP
 | |
| .B 500-999
 | |
| specifies the second 500 bytes
 | |
| .TP
 | |
| .B -500
 | |
| specifies the last 500 bytes
 | |
| .TP
 | |
| .B 9500-
 | |
| specifies the bytes from offset 9500 and forward
 | |
| .TP
 | |
| .B 0-0,-1
 | |
| specifies the first and last byte only(*)(HTTP)
 | |
| .TP
 | |
| .B 100-199,500-599
 | |
| specifies two separate 100-byte ranges(*) (HTTP)
 | |
| .RE
 | |
| .IP
 | |
| (*) = NOTE that this will cause the server to reply with a multipart
 | |
| response!
 | |
| 
 | |
| Only digit characters (0-9) are valid in the 'start' and 'stop' fields of the
 | |
| \&'start-stop' range syntax. If a non-digit character is given in the range,
 | |
| the server's response will be unspecified, depending on the server's
 | |
| configuration.
 | |
| 
 | |
| You should also be aware that many HTTP/1.1 servers do not have this feature
 | |
| enabled, so that when you attempt to get a range, you'll instead get the whole
 | |
| document.
 | |
| 
 | |
| FTP and SFTP range downloads only support the simple 'start-stop' syntax
 | |
| (optionally with one of the numbers omitted). FTP use depends on the extended
 | |
| FTP command SIZE.
 | |
| 
 | |
| If this option is used several times, the last one will be used.
